Finding Reliable Window Installers: A Comprehensive Guide

Changing or installing new windows is an investment that can substantially enhance the visual appeal, energy effectiveness, and total worth of a home. However, the success of this project heavily relies on working with the right window installer. This article aims to offer property owners with a thorough understanding of how to find trusted window installers, making sure that this vital home improvement job is performed smoothly and expertly.

Importance of Choosing the Right Window Installer

When it pertains to window installation, cutting corners by working with unskilled or unqualified installers can result in a host of problems, such as:

  • Improper Installation: Can cause air leaks, water invasion, and reduced energy performance.
  • Guarantee Issues: Many window producers require professional installation to promote service warranty validity.
  • Safety Hazards: Incorrectly set up windows might posture safety risks, especially in case of extreme climate condition.

Provided these ramifications, discovering a skilled window installer is vital. Here are a number of actions and tips to assist homeowners in their search.

Steps to Find Window Installers

1. Research Local Installers

The primary step in your search ought to involve local research study. Use various resources to put together a list of prospective window installers in your area.

  • Online Search: Websites like Google and Yelp can provide consumer evaluations and rankings.
  • Social Media: Platforms such as Facebook and Instagram can display installers' work and customer feedback.
  • Word of Mouth: Speak to good friends, family, or next-door neighbors who recently undertook window installations.

2. Examine Qualifications and Experience

Once you have a list of prospective installers, checking their qualifications is vital:

  • Licensing: Ensure the specialist has the needed licenses to run in your state or area.
  • Insurance: Verify that they have liability insurance and worker's payment to protect you from any liability during the installation.
  • Experience: Ask the length of time they have remained in the window installation service and whether they concentrate on residential or commercial jobs.

3. Seek Quotes and Compare Prices

After limiting your options, demand quotes from a minimum of three various installers. Here are some considerations:

  • Ensure that each quote consists of a breakdown of expenses, products, and services.
  • Be careful of incredibly low bids, as they may indicate subpar materials or unskilled labor.
  • Inquire about funding alternatives if necessary.

4. Request References and Review Past Work

A trusted installer should have a portfolio of previous jobs and a list of recommendations:

  • Contact References: Speak with previous customers about their experience, the quality of work, and whether the job was finished on time and within budget.
  • Check Out Completed Projects: If possible, check out previous installations to assess the quality firsthand.

5. Evaluate Customer Service

Good client service can be the differentiator in between a satisfying and extraordinary experience:

  • Are they responsive to inquiries and concerns?
  • Do they provide clear descriptions about the installation procedure?

6. Understand Warranties

Inquire about the guarantees supplied by both the window manufacturer and the installer. A strong warranty can use comfort relating to quality:

  • Window Manufacturer's Warranty: Typically covers the window itself.
  • Installer's Warranty: Often covers labor and craftsmanship for a set period.

Expenses Associated with Window Installation

Understanding the monetary aspect of window installation is vital. The expenses can vary substantially based upon factors such as:

  1. Type of Windows: Different window designs and products (vinyl, wood, fiberglass, etc) can have varying expenses.
  2. Number of Windows: More windows lead to greater labor and material expenditures.
  3. Installation Complexity: Special setups, such as those needing substantial frame work or replacements, might increase costs.

Average Cost Breakdown

Window TypeAverage Price Range (per window)
Vinyl₤ 400 - ₤ 800
Wood₤ 800 - ₤ 2,000
Fiberglass₤ 900 - ₤ 1,500
Aluminum₤ 300 - ₤ 700

FAQs

What should I look for in a window installer?

Secret qualities include legitimate licenses, insurance, experience, consumer reviews, and service warranty offerings.

The length of time does window installation usually take?

The installation time varies depending on the variety of windows and intricacy, but the majority of installations can be completed within a day or 2.

Are there financing options offered for window installations?

Numerous installers use funding strategies or can advise lending institutions to assist house owners in handling expenses.

Can I DIY my window installation?

While some house owners may go with DIY, professional installation is advised to avoid potential pitfalls that feature lack of experience.

What can I do to prepare for window installation?

Cleaning up the area around the windows, eliminating window treatments, and guaranteeing access to electricity can help facilitate a smoother installation process.
